Lacey Spears Found Guilty of Poisoning Son To Death

CrimeBy Joe LevinMarch 2, 2015Leave a comment

The mommy blogger who slowly killed her son using lethal doses of salt was found guilty of his murder Monday. After more than two days of deliberation, a Westchester County Court jury convicted 27-year-old Lacey Spears with second-degree murder following a month-long trial, according to the Journal News.

Report: Obama Has Cut Intelligence Cooperation with Israel

Israel, SecurityBy Joe LevinMarch 2, 2015Leave a comment

In response to Prime Minister Binyamin Netanyahu’s opposition to the nuclear deal he warns threatens Israel’s very existence, US President Barack Obama’s administration has reportedly cut American intelligence cooperation with Israel.

Netanyahu Tells AIPAC That US-Israel Alliance Strong, World Must Not Let Iran Go Nuclear

IsraelBy Joe LevinMarch 2, 2015Leave a comment

Washington –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u insisted Monday that despite recent differences with the Obama administration over a looming nuclear deal with Iran the alliance between his country and the Unites States was “stronger than ever.”

Anti-Israel Protesters Stage Sit-In Amid Netanyahu Visit

Anti Semitism, IsraelBy Joe LevinMarch 2, 2015Leave a comment

Anti-Israel protesters donned Benjamin Netanyahu masks and smeared their hands with fake blood for a Sunday sit-in against the Israeli prime minister in Washington. Activists led by the radical CODEPINK group demonstrated outside the pro-Israel AIPAC lobby’s annual conference at the Walter E. Washington Convention Center.

Twitter, Law Enforcement Investigate Alleged Islamic State Threats

SecurityBy Joe LevinMarch 2, 2015Leave a comment

Washington – Twitter Inc and law enforcement authorities are investigating alleged threats made by Islamic State militants against the social media network’s co-founder and other employees, the company said in reaction to media reports.

Kerry Warns Netanyahu Against Revealing Iran Talks Details

IsraelBy Joe LevinMarch 2, 2015Leave a comment

US Secretary of State John Kerry on Monday appeared to warn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u against revealing in his upcoming speech to the US Congress details of an Iran nuclear deal that world powers are currently negotiating.
